Polyamide (nylon) Barrier Packaging Market was valued at USD 3.6 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 5.1 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 4.5% from 2024 to 2030.
The Polyamide (Nylon) Barrier Packaging market is growing steadily due to the material's excellent barrier properties, which make it suitable for various applications. The demand for polyamide (nylon) packaging is expected to rise due to its versatility in food, healthcare, consumer goods, and other sectors. Polyamide is known for its resistance to heat, moisture, and chemicals, making it an ideal choice for packaging sensitive products. With an increasing focus on sustainable packaging solutions and advancements in material science, polyamide (nylon) packaging is likely to witness continued growth in the coming years.

Pol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ging is widely used in the food industry due to its excellent properties such as resistance to moisture, gases, and UV light, which help in preserving the freshness and shelf life of food products. It provides a reliable barrier that ensures the safe transport of perishable food items such as meats, dairy, snacks, and ready-to-eat meals. The ability of polyamide (nylon) packaging to withstand high temperatures also makes it suitable for food that requires heat sealing or sterilization. Additionally, polyamide-based packaging is increasingly being utilized for frozen foods, dry foods, and convenience foods that need to maintain quality and taste during storage and transport. This wide applicability in the food sector is driven by both consumer demand for fresh products and manufacturers' need for robust packaging solutions that can extend product shelf life. The healthcare sector is another significant application area for pol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ging. It is used for medical devices, pharmaceutical products, and various healthcare applications due to its excellent barrier properties that protect sensitive contents from external factors such as moisture, oxygen, and bacteria. Polyamide packaging provides essential protection to pharmaceuticals, ensuring that they remain effective and safe for use. It also helps to reduce contamination risks during the distribution and storage of medical products. Additionally, the material is increasingly used in blister packs, vials, and syringes, where it offers optimal protection against damage while ensuring that the product remains sterile. The healthcare industry demands high-performance packaging materials, and polyamide barrier packaging meets this requirement with its versatility and reliability.

Beyond the food, healthcare, and consumer goods industries, pol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ging is also utilized in a range of other applications, including industrial and electronic product packaging. The material is favored for its durability, resistance to wear and tear, and its ability to provide superior protection for sensitive items during shipping and storage. In the electronics sector, polyamide packaging is used to protect components such as microchips, circuit boards, and batteries, ensuring that these delicate products remain secure and undamaged throughout their journey to the end user. Its ability to withstand extreme environmental conditions, including temperature fluctuations and exposure to chemicals, makes it highly suitable for such high-stakes applications.Polyamide packaging is also used in the packaging of industrial parts, automotive components, and even textiles. 1. What is pol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ging?
Pol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ging is a type of packaging that uses nylon or polyamide-based materials to provide protection against moisture, gases, and other environmental factors. It is commonly used in food, healthcare, and consumer goods packaging.
2. Why is polyamide (nylon) packaging preferred for food products?
Polyamide (nylon) packaging is preferred for food products because of its excellent barrier properties, which help preserve food freshness and extend shelf life by preventing exposure to moisture and oxygen.
3. Is polyamide (nylon) packaging environmentally friendly?
Polyamide (nylon) packaging is evolving to offer recyclable and biodegradable options, helping to address sustainability concerns in packaging. However, its environmental impact depends on the recycling practices in place.
4. What are the benefits of polyamide packaging in the healthcare industry?
Polyamide packaging in healthcare offers superior protection against moisture, oxygen, and contamination, ensuring the safety and integrity of pharmaceutical products, medical devices, and other healthcare supplies.
5. Can polyamide (nylon) packaging be used for personal care products?
Yes, polyamide (nylon) packaging is used in the personal care industry for products like lotions, shampoos, and creams, providing a reliable barrier to moisture and contamination.
6. How does polyamide packaging protect food from contamination?
Polyamide packaging forms a strong barrier that prevents the entry of oxygen, moisture, and other contaminants, which helps to preserve the quality, taste, and safety of the food inside.
7. What makes polyamide (nylon) packaging suitable for medical devices?
Polyamide (nylon) packaging is ideal for medical devices due to its resistance to punctures, excellent sealing properties, and ability to protect against environmental factors like moisture and bacteria.
8. Are there any advancements in polyamide packaging technology?
Yes, ongoing advancements include improving barrier properties, developing more sustainable materials, and incorporating smart packaging technologies that monitor the condition of packaged products.
9. How does polyamide packaging contribute to sustainability?
Polyamide packaging is contributing to sustainability by being recyclable, reducing plastic waste, and offering eco-friendly alternatives that minimize environmental impact.
10. What industries are adopting pol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ging?
Polyamide (nylon) barrier packaging is being adopted across various industries, including food, healthcare, consumer goods, and electronics, due to its excellent protection properties and versatility.
